David Bennett Cohen

A musician whose lengthy profession traversed from Broadway towards the blues, David Bennett Cohen began monitoring classical piano at age seven, 2 yrs later starting to train himself your guitar. As a teenager he noticed boogie-woogie piano for the very first time, the beginning of a life-long obsession using the blues; nevertheless, he initially discovered success in the dawn from the psychedelic period, signing on because the initial keyboardist in Nation Joe as well as the Fish. Furthermore to dealing with the Blues Task, Mick Taylor, Tim Hardin, Jimi Hendrix, Johnny Winter season, Huey Lewis, Michael Bloomfield and Bob Weir within the years to check out, Cohen also loved a solo profession, sharing expenses with Bonnie Raitt, Richard Thompson, Jerry Garcia, Leo Kottke, Rufus Thomas among others. His Broadway tenure included a stint playing keyboards and acoustic guitar within the touring creation from the smash Lease; through the 1990s, he also supported previous Johnny Copeland sideman Bobby Kyle. Additionally, Cohen authored a set of instructional books, David Bennett Cohen Shows Blues Piano, Quantities I and II, that have been released with associated CDs; for Homespun Tapes, he also documented two audio-teaching tape series (Blues/Rock and roll Piano and Ragtime Piano) along with a three-volume videotape series (Blues Piano). Additionally, a set of acoustic guitar instruction LPs had been issued from the Kicking Mule label.
